Wordly Wise Books Coming
Wordly Wise vocabulary workbooks will be coming home soon! Students will be using this program to enrich their vocabulary and help them to employ more specific words in their writing.
Please know that students will each be given their own books and therefore will be responsible not to lose them.

I wanted to tell you a little bit about what our class will
be doing the very first quarter in English class. Each quarter I will send out a letter
outlining the areas that we will be covering in class, and I promise to keep it
as simple as possible. This year, our
theme is a “hero.” We will be using this
theme to guide us through our curriculum.
We will not only focus on the hero in our readings but also the hero
within all of us.
Quarter 1 students will…..
*learn how to cite evidence from a variety of literary texts and infer
*be introduced to “research” and how to do it correctly
*write a five paragraph narrative essay
(ongoing practice)
*write journals as practice for writing (ongoing practice)
*determine and analyze themes and central ideas
*write informative/explanatory texts to examine topics and convey ideas
*enrich their vocabulary through Wordly Wise (all year)
*engage continuously in Higher Order Thinking practices
